    • Respective movements and positions of traffic participants arranged within a monitoring range surrounding a motor vehicle are captured on the front side, on the rear side, and/or laterally, by several sensors of the motor vehicle. One characteristic value per traffic participant is established which quantifies a collision probability of the motor vehicle with the respective traffic participants in dependency on the captured movements and positions of the traffic participants and the movement and position of the motor vehicle. At least one warning message is issued with respect to the traffic participants, for which the established characteristic values reach a predetermined collision probability value, wherein the warning message is signaled in which direction of the motor vehicle the respective collisions are impending.

    • A parking assist system for a vehicle includes a camera and a display operable to display video images of an exterior scene derived from image data captured by the camera. A controller, when operating in a first or parking space locator mode, adds an overlay to the displayed video images. The overlay includes (i) a polygonal representation of the vehicle and (ii) a linear overlay extending along one side of the polygonal representation of the vehicle. The polygonal representation is offset behind and laterally from the vehicle. The controller is operable in the first mode while the vehicle is being driven by a driver of the vehicle and, with the overlay added to displayed video images, the driver maneuvers the vehicle to position the polygonal representation at a displayed target parking location. The linear overlay assists the driver in parking the vehicle at the target parking location.

    • In a structure, which securely attaches a component to an opening portion in a plate-shaped member without stripping or turning over the plate-shaped member, each of a pair of mount members includes a first engagement portion engaged with a rear surface side of the plate-shaped member and a second engagement portion engaged with the component. The component includes projecting portions to be fitted between the mount members to enable fixing against coming off by engagement of the second engagement portion and the component. The projecting portions inhibit the mount members from moving so as not to come off the opening portion. Since the second engagement portion is formed from the multiple step portions engageable with the component, engagement with the component may be done even if plate thickness of the plate-shaped member varies, enabling fixing without backlash and improving versatility to the plate-shaped member having different plate thickness.
